WebMar 2, 2024 · FEA is widely used for structural analysis in the civil, automotive, and aeronautic sectors. For a given load, FEA software such as Ansys Mechanical solves for an equilibrium condition in the structure. WebAug 3, 2015 · The most basic form of buckling analysis in FEA is linear buckling. This is directly related to the classic Euler type of calculation. A small displacement of a perturbed shape is assumed in each element that induces a stress dependent stiffening effect. This adds to the linear static stiffness in the element.
